A Seattle-based rapper and pop-culture icon, Macklemore, will be visiting Boise this fall and it's sure to be one of the most high energy shows of the entire year. Known best for his hits 'Can't Hold Us' and 'Thrift Shop', Macklemore has a stage presence unlike most artists and it doesn't matter how long it's been since his big hits were released, they are universal party anthems.
The show will be taking place at Idaho Central Arena in the heart of downtown Boise on October 12th! Tickets will be on sale at 10:00 a.m. on March 10th--so set those reminders if you want to lock in great seats for the concert!
